<br />~ <br /> <br />Session 1562, Minutes <br />January 27, 1992 <br /> <br />Page 6 <br /> <br />Mr. Ollendorff said the split vote reflected that this location has been a <br />City eyesore for many years, arxl that previous operators ignored city laws <br />that regulate this kirrl of operation. He said council should be fully satis- <br />fied that the applicant has both the willingness arxl monetary ability to <br />clean up the property arxl keep it that way. <br /> <br />Mr. Adams, noting that similar operations sometimes have not done a good job <br />keeping their premises clean or the nmnber of cars at an allowable level, ex- <br />pressed COnceITl about the City's recourse if the operator refuses to comply <br />with regulations. <br /> <br />Responding to Mr. Price, Mr. Ollendorff said the City can get compliance, but <br />with an unwilling operator it may take some time arxl involve court dates, arxl <br />neighbors often get upset before the conditions are corrected. <br /> <br />Mr. Harvey Feldman, 9660 Olive Blvd., attorney representing the operator, Mr. <br />Feygelrnan, came forward. Mr. Feldman said his client would comply with all <br />conditions, arxl certainly understood that. this site at the east entrance of <br />University city was a sensitive location. Mr. Feldman felt it was not quite <br />fair to transfer negative feelings concerning the previous operation to the <br />new operator, arxl he assured council that Mr. Feygelrnan will keep the site <br />clean. He said the area behirrl the building will be enclosed in some way to <br />discourage nighttime Parking, arxl all automotive work will be done indoors, <br />with no derelict vehicles on premises. Mr. Feygelrnan, 16408 Audubon Village <br />Drive, Grover, came forward arxl said a store selling liquor is next to his <br />business, arxl he often finds liquor bottles arxl other debris on the premises, <br />which he cleans up every day. In response to Mr. Ollendorff, Mr. Feygelrnan <br />said any cars kept overnight will always be kept inside the building. <br /> <br />Mrs. Schuman pointed out the May 1st deadline on several of the conditions, <br />arxl said she will insist strenuously that the work be finished by then. <br /> <br />Mr. Schoomer said the store selling liquor was in st. IDuis, but would be re- <br />ceptive to complaints either to the excise commissioner or the aldennan in <br />that ward. Also, the SPecial Benefit Tax District Board of Directors dis- <br />cussed this matter, arxl there seemed to be consensus that Mr. Feygelrnan was <br />conducting this operation better than the previous operator. <br /> <br />Mrs. Schuman said she agreed with the Plan Corrnnission member who felt this <br />use was not compatible with other retail business in the loop, however, the <br />site has held this type of business for many years. She emphasized that the <br />operation will be watched carefully arxl all conditions strictly enforced. <br /> <br />Mr. Price moved approval with all conditions, but adding another condition-- <br />that the site be policed daily to remove trash, rubbish arxl debris. Mrs. <br />Schuman seconded the motion, which carried unanim:>usly. <br /> <br />SITE PIAN - 6315 MAPIE AVENUE <br /> <br />'!he city Manager reconunended approval of the site plan proPosed by wince> Re- <br />
